Hi HN, I forked chromium and built agent-browser-protocol (ABP) after noticing that most browser-agent failures aren’t really about the model misunderstanding the page. Instead, the problem is that the model is reasoning from a stale state. ABP is designed to keep the acting agent synchronized with the browser at every step. After each action (click, type, etc), it freezes JavaScript execution and rendering, then captures the resulting state. It also compiles the notable events that occurred during that action loop, such as navigation, file pickers, permission prompts, alerts, and downloads,…

Single-agent LLMs suck at long-running complex tasks. We’ve open-sourced a multi-agent orchestrator that we’ve been using to handle long-running LLM tasks. We found that single LLM agents tend to stall, loop, or generate non-compiling code, so we built a harness for agents to coordinate over shared context while work is in progress. How it works: 1. Orchestrator agent that manages task decomposition 2. Sub-agents for parallel work 3. Subscriptions to task state and progress 4. Real-time sharing of intermediate discoveries between agents We tested this on a Putnam-level math problem, but the…

1. Headless mode Headless mode allows you to use the AI as a command-line utility for automation and scripting. In Claude Code you run it with the -p flag: claude -p, in codex - exec, opencode - run. 2. Ask human The traditional communication channel with the operator won't work in headless mode - we need to implement a dedicated tool. Here is an example of how this can be done https://github.com/sermakarevich/claude/tree/main/mcp/ask_hu... 3. Tasks queue Beads is a lightweight distributed graph issue tracker for AI agents, powered by Dolt. You can…

Hello all, I'm a software developer. Over the last few months more and more of my work has turned into using coding agents instead of typing the whole code myself. Usually a few claude sessions at once, sometimes codex, one per feature or per revealed bug. I ran them in a split terminal for a few weeks, and quickly spotted two main problems. The first is that I couldn't easily tell which agent was stuck waiting on me and which was still working, so I'd cycle through sessions and checking on them. The second one: agents sharing a single branch step on each other. Two of them could be editing…
